USMC state plate plus a 3-inch window decal. Other than that, not much. Got an incident to share.

Some people put religious, military, other insignia on their cars to signal cops that "they're okay." Especially USMC stuff, because so many cops are Jarheads. (Which is decreasing, too bad.) When I was a cop, I pulled over a guy on a red light. He didn't have a veteran plate, but he had a Globe & Anchor decal stuck on his passenger plate (illegal). He also had a small USMC decal on his drivers license. What kind of Marine is this?

With his drivers license and registration in hand, I asked him a few trick questions. Conversation, almost verbatim:
"So, Paris Island or San Diego?" (Where did he go through basic.)
"Sorry, Officer, I thought the light was yellow." (It wasn't.)
"What was your MOS?" (Military Occupational Specialty--you NEVER forget your MOS.)
"Wasn't it yellow? I'm sure it was, Officer."

I returned to the cruiser and wrote him the fines for the red light and alteration of his license plate. Returning with the ticket, I asked him about the USMC regalia.
"Oh, I have a brother in the Marines," he (tried to) explained.
Yeah, sure you do, I thought. I told the fake gyrene how to answer the ticket and sent him on his way.

We just got home from a trip to Wyoming... Visited the national military vehicle museum in Duboise. Awesome collection. The owner did a tour himself... Bought his first tank in 2010, second one in 2014, and now has over 500! Not to mention Higgins boats, jeeps, artillery pieces, the Bunker Hill musket, USS Missouri naval gun breaches, half tracks, motorcycles, air craft, and more. The tour in the building is 1 1/2 miles long and spans WWI through the Vietnam era.
The current building is 144,000 SF, with lots of vehicles outside, and apparently that's only about half of what he has... Plans are in the works to expand already. Really nice guy. Super patriotic. Never served but obviously loves his country and appreciates anyone who served.
